Standing Side Circle Stretch

Loosen up your torso! This gentle stretch improves flexibility and posture with easy circular movements.

Instructions

  1. Starting Position:

    • Stand tall with your feet shoulder-width apart.

    • Keep your knees slightly bent.

    • Relax your arms at your sides and engage your core.

  2. Arm Positioning:

    • Raise your right arm overhead, ensuring that your elbow is straight.

    • Place your left hand on your hip for balance.

  3. Movement:

    • Slowly lean to the left side, feeling a stretch along the right side of your body.

    • Hold this position for a few seconds, breathing deeply.

  4. Circular Motion:

    • From the left side, begin to move your right hand in a circular motion.

    • Start moving the arm forward, then allow it to travel back and down, completing a full circle.

    • Make the circle as large as is comfortable.

  5. Repetition:

    • After completing 8-10 circles, return your right arm to the overhead position.

    • Slowly return to the starting position.

  6. Switch Sides:

    • Repeat the same process with your left arm, raising it overhead and leaning to the right.

    • Perform circles with your left arm as you did with your right.

  7. Cool Down:

    • Finish by standing tall and take a few deep breaths, feeling the stretch in both sides of your body.

Tips:

  • Keep your movements slow and controlled to prevent injury.

  • Focus on your breathing to enhance relaxation during the stretch.

  • If you have any discomfort, lessen the range of motion.
